There are numerous walks immediately from the door, stroll down the road outside the cottage to Gallox Bridge and beyond into Dunster deer park and the Crown Estate. Explore Bats Castle, an Iron Age hill fort or explore Dunster Castle (National Trust) and their beautiful grounds. In the opposite direction there are footpaths which lead up onto Grabbist Hill or to Conygar Tower. Exmoor National Park Centre in Dunster can provide you with lots of walks, maps, activities bespoke to you and your exploration of Exmoor. This is a magical part of Exmoor to walk in, cycle through, the Quantock Hills are close by and a stunning coast-line to enjoy awaits you!
Dunster has its own beach, complete with beach huts and is approx 1.5 mile walk from the village. The beach is dog friendly 365 days a year.
West Somerset Steam Railway runs from Minehead through Dunster, stopping at Blue Anchor beach, Washford and on to Bishops Lydeard and is a nostalgic, thoroughly enjoyable day out one that pleases all ages!

The region
Dunster is a medieval village on the edge of Exmoor National Park in West Somerset, dominated by its magnificent castle perched on a wooded hilltop above the High Street.
Often described as one of the most intact medieval villages in England, Dunster has a rich history stretching back over a thousand years. The iconic octagonal Yarn Market, built in the early 1600s, sits at the heart of the village -- a reminder of its prosperous wool-trading past. The broad High Street is lined with independent shops, galleries, tea rooms, and characterful pubs, many housed in listed buildings dating from the 15th and 16th centuries.
The village has its own Post Office with a cash machine, a deli, and a good range of places to eat and drink. For larger supermarkets, banks, and petrol stations, the coastal town of Minehead is just 1.5 miles away -- Tesco and Morrisons are both on the outskirts with long opening hours. Most shops in Dunster keep traditional hours of 9am to 5pm, often extending in summer.
Dunster hosts a lively programme of events throughout the year, including the Dunster Show, Dunster Country Fair, and the much-loved Winter Festival in early December when the village is lit by candlelight with music, dancing, and medieval re-enactments in the streets.
